About Valery...

My name is Valery. I’m from small town Serdobsk in the central part of Russia. Previously, it was an industrial town, and now all plants are closed. So the town gets smaller every year. I myself living in Moscow, but I bring children here in the summer. Here is a river, a nature, a forest etc. I have two boys and a girl. They also like to receive postcards.
